在使用C語言的fmax函數時,需要注意以下幾點:
包含正確的頭文件:需要在程序中包含math.h頭文件,以便使用fmax函數。
確保傳入正確的參數:fmax函數需要傳入兩個參數,分別是兩個浮點數。確保傳入的參數類型正確,否則會出現編譯錯誤。
處理返回值:fmax函數會返回兩個參數中較大的那個值,需要將返回值賦給一個變量或者直接使用返回值進行操作。
注意邊界情況:當傳入的參數中有NaN(Not a Number)時,fmax函數會返回NaN。需要在程序中處理這種情況。
示例代碼如下:
#include <stdio.h>
#include <math.h>
int main() {
double a = 5.6;
double b = 8.9;
double max_value = fmax(a, b);
printf("The maximum value is: %f\n", max_value);
return 0;
}
在這個示例代碼中,我們使用fmax函數計算兩個浮點數a和b中的較大值,并將結果賦給max_value變量,然后輸出最大值。